County Road 224 starts in the Angeline Conservation Area and transitions to the Ozark National Scenic Riverways, ending at Jerktail Landing on the Current River. The easy gravel road starts on a ridge line and then drops into the valley. At the end of the trail are two camping options. The first is a primitive campground with tables and fire rings, or there are several areas on the large gravel bar to set up camp. There is also a vault toilet close by. A large cliff on the far side of the river makes for a great view. There is also a boat ramp and crystal-clear water that is pretty deep in sections.
